Cheapest Available Old World Third Street 1 Bedroom Apartments

Currently the lowest priced 1 Bedroom apartment unit Old World Third Street of Milwaukee, WI is the One Bedroom Model starting from $680 at Edgewater East. The average price for all 1 Bedroom apartments in Old World Third Street is currently $1,815. Here is today’s list of the cheapest available 1 Bedroom options in the area:

Frequently Asked Questions about 1 Bedroom Old World Third Street Apartments

What is the Cheapest apartment in Old World Third Street with 1 Bedroom?

Currently the most affordable 1 Bedroom in Old World Third Street is at Edgewater East listed at $680.

How much is the average rent for a 1 Bedroom Old World Third Street Apartment?

The average rent for a 1 Bedroom Apartment in Old World Third Street is $1,815.

What is the largest available 1 Bedroom Old World Third Street Apartment for rent?

Today's apartment with the most square footage in Old World Third Street is a 1,250 square feet unit starting from $2,270 at Elevation 1659.

What is the average size for Old World Third Street 1 Bedroom Apartments for rent?

The average size for a 1 Bedroom rental in Old World Third Street is currently 728 sq ft.
